Molecular insights into α2 adrenergic receptor function: clinical implications

Efferent signaling from the sympathetic nervous system integrates myriad vital functions. Modulation of sympathetic neuron signaling occurs in part by feedback inhibition of neurotransmitter release, mediated largely via α2a and/or α2c adrenergic receptors (α2a&c ARs). This review will describe an overview of our current understanding of α2a&c AR biology, clinical implications of these findings, and the possible clinical importance of genetic variants of α2a&c ARs.
